Anderson is a distinctive boys' name in United States, ranking #808 in 1996 with 178 recorded births. The name reached its all-time peak in 2012 with 1,249 births ranking #280. Anderson began as a surname meaning "son of Andrew" and now also works as a given name. It has a polished surname-style feel while still carrying a clear family-name meaning.
Like many modern first names, Anderson moved from surname use into the given-name column. Its rise fits the broader trend for tailored, surname-style boys' names.
